Action item (PM-12, Quillbank ledger): rounding drift in multi-hop currency conversion caused cent-level discrepancies in settlement reports. Fix: round only at final presentation, carry full precision internally, and assert parity against the reference converter in CI. Contractor onboarding note: do not touch the scale parameters without a reviewer from the ledger team. Current tuning constants are set out below.

tuning constants:
RATE_LIMITS = {
    "wenwyn": 1,
    "zorix": 10,
    "oliix": 2,
    "holael": 10,
}

## Deployment — LotPulse Occupancy Feed

LotPulse publishes garage occupancy counts from the Harwick sensor gateways every 15 seconds. Deploy via the standard pipeline: build the container, run the contract tests against the staging gateway simulator, then roll out with a 10% canary for at least one commuter rush period. Maintainers should never deploy during the 07:00–09:00 window, since sensor reconnect storms mask regressions. After rollout, verify the pods loaded the expected settings, reproduced below for comparison.

deployment values, yadug-bawif:
[framir]
team = pelox
access_code = ac_a38ab2
owner = tamion.julael
host = framir.tolvaqlabs.test
port = 11211
peer = tammir.zemvargrid.local
salt = 2215ef03
pin = 1541

- [ ] Step 7: Archive cold storage buckets (Glacierline tier). Confirm both ceremony witnesses are present, verify bucket manifests match the Oxbow ledger, then seal the archive key shares. Plugin authors may observe but not handle shares. Once sealed, the archive index itself is encrypted and can only be reopened with the passphrase below.

vault phrase of badup-hahig = tamael-aldael-kelmir-istael-fenok-istwyn-tamius-jorath-oliion